  • Rule 33. Interrogatories to Parties | Federal Rules of Civil Procedure . . .
    Unlike Rules 30 (d) and 37 (a), Rule 33 imposes no sanction of expenses on a party whose objections are clearly unjustified Rule 33 assures that the objections will lead directly to court, through its requirement that they be served with a notice of hearing

  • Rule 33. Interrogatories to Parties – Civil Procedure - USLegal
    An interrogatory may relate to any matter that may be inquired into under Rule 26 (b) An interrogatory is not objectionable merely because it asks for an opinion or contention that relates to fact or the application of law to fact, but the court may order that the interrogatory need not be answered until designated discovery is complete, or
  • Microsoft Word - Rule 33 Final - United States Courts
    Each interrogatory must, to the extent it is not objected to, be answered separately and fully in writing under oath Rule 33-2 (4) Objections The grounds for objecting to an interrogatory must be stated with specificity Any ground not stated in a timely objection is waived unless the court, for good cause, excuses the failure

  • Microsoft Word - RULE 33. doc
    For the purposes of the rule, subparts of interrogatories are deemed to be separate interrogatories The intent of the rule is to limit the total number of interrogatories served and to encourage simple, direct questions rather than elaborate form questions containing multiple parts
